JavaScript document.write()

JavaScript document.write(),从这个方法名称就可以猜到它的功能。显然它不是弹出对话框,而是直接向HTML文档写入字符,如图所示。

<script>document.write("Here is another message");</script>

JavaScript document.write()

说明:
实际上,无论从功能来说,还是从编码风格与可维护性来说,document.write都是一种向页面输出内容的笨拙方式,它有很多的局限性。大多数正规的JavaScript程序员都不会使用这种方式,更好的方式是使用JavaScript和DOM。

在介绍一种编程语言时,如果不使用传统的“Hello World!”范例似乎说不过去。这个简单的HTML文档如程序清单所示。

程序清单 一个alert()对话框中的“Hello World!”

<!DOCTYPE html>
<html>
<head>
    <title>Hello from JavaScript!</title>
</head>
<body>
    <script>
          alert("Hello World!");
    </script>
</body>
</html>

在文本编辑器里创建一个文档,将其命名为hello.html,输入上述代码,保存到计算机,然后在浏览器中打开它。

注意:留意文件名后缀
有些文本编辑器会尝试给我们指定的文件名添加.txt扩展名,因此在保存文件时要确保使用了.html扩展名,否则浏览器可能不会正常打开它。

几乎全部操作系统都允许我们用鼠标右键单击HTML文件图标,从弹出菜单里选择“打开方式”(或类似的字眼)。另一种打开方式是先运行喜欢的浏览器,然后从菜单栏里选择“文件”>“打开”,找到相应的文件,加载到浏览器。

这时会看到前图所示的对话框,但其中的内容是“Hello World!”。如果计算机里安装了多个浏览器,可以尝试用它们都来打开这个文件,比较得到的结果。对话框外观可能有细微差别,但信息和“OK”按钮都是一样的。

注意:小心警告
有些浏览器的默认安全设置会在打开本地内容(比如本地计算机上的文件)时显示警告内容,如果看到这样的提示,只要选择允许继续操作即可。

酷客网相关文章:

赞(0)

评论 抢沙发

评论前必须登录!